Damp & Mould Surveyor

Location: Cambourne, Cambridge (on site 3/4 days a week)

6 Month Minimum Contract

Hourly Rate: Negotiable + Mileage

Sellick Partnership Ltd are supporting a Housing organisation with the recruitment of a Damp and Mould Surveyor to join their team on a temporary ongoing basis due to the increase in demand from Awaabs Law

Key Responsibilities of the Damp and Mould Surveyor will include:

  • To undertake surveys in customer's homes, where damp, mould or disrepair has been reported
  • To diagnose causes of potential damp/mould/condensation and the required rectification works
  • To instruct and manage the identified works within their financial sign-off, both utilising the internal repairs team and the special contractors as required
  • To agree variations with 3rd party contractors as required during the progress of the works
  • To provide an excellent customer service to our customers and work with them to get the best out of their homes and prevent the re-occurrence of damp and mould
  • To have an awareness of the current Construction Design Management (CDM) regulations and ensure, in liaison with the Contracts Manager, that all works are within compliance

The successful Damp and Mould Surveyor will have:

  • Educated to a minimum of HNC or equivalent (Preferred)
  • Full valid UK driving licence
  • Understanding of housing health and safety systems (HHSRS)
  • Knowledge of NHF Schedule of rates
